Title

DEMONETIZATION AND CAPITAL GAIN TAX: A STUDY

Authors

Abstract

Abstract: Demonetization is a process through which the currency of a country is declared null and void and is replaced by the new currency. In India demonetization has been introduced three times. But most recent instance has affected majority of the people in India. The objective of this process as stated in the notification authorizing demonetization was to restrict terrorist activities in the country which were being funded by antisocial elements through fake currency notes. In the beginning the people were supporting this activity but later on while facing the consequences of unplanned activity; public at large opposed it and even number of petitions were filed in the High Court and Supreme Court challenging validity of demonetization. But the important point to be considered here is that all black money is not in cash. Rather it is being converted into other forms such as precious metals and property. The government should make effective policy to broaden tax base and provide adequate relief to the tax payers. The provisions relating to application of capital gain tax must be revised and checks in the system must be included to eliminate occurrence of black money at different stages.
